Trump Media Bitcoin Holdings Slip as Digital Asset Losses Reach $360.6 MillionTrump Media and Technology Group reported a smaller bitcoin position at the end of June as the fair value of its crypto assets declined. The update followed the collapse of planned Crypto.com-linked initiatives, including a proposed CRO treasury company and an ETF servicing partnership.

Trump Media Pulls Back From Crypto.com CRO Treasury Plan as Token FallsTrump Media, Crypto.com and Yorkville Acquisition have terminated plans for a publicly traded company focused on accumulating and staking CRO. The move marks a sharp pullback from Trump Media’s crypto expansion as the firm redirects attention toward media, data licensing and a proposed fusion-energy merger.

Trump Media Bitcoin Holdings Narrow Toward Collateral Level After Crypto.com TransferWallets tied to Trump Media moved 2,628 bitcoin worth about $165 million to Crypto.com, leaving roughly 4,261 bitcoin in tagged addresses. The remaining balance now closely matches the 4,260.73 bitcoin the company previously listed as collateral for convertible notes, making its next 10-Q central to understanding whether the transfers were custody movements or sales.
